ADP vs SNOW
Automatic Data Processing, Inc. and Snowflake Inc. side by side — fundamentals from SEC filings, refreshed nightly. Sector: Technology.
| Automatic Data Processing, Inc. (ADP) | Snowflake Inc. (SNOW) | |
|---|---|---|
| Market cap | $92.4B | $82.7B |
| Revenue (latest FY) | $20.56B | $4.68B |
| Net income (latest FY) | $4.08B | $-1.33B |
| Revenue growth (5y CAGR) | 7.1% | 51.2% |
| Net margin | 19.8% | -28.4% |
| Return on equity | 65.9% | -69.2% |
| P/E ratio | 21.6 | — |
| Dividend yield | 3.0% | — |
| Profitable years (of last 10) | 10 | 0 |
| Positive free cash flow | — | Yes |
